Built in 1826 and formerly used as a trading post for miners, this house bears the honor of being Galena's, as well as Illinois', oldest stone structure. It's constructed of limestone and contains primitive furniture, artifacts and other antiques. The house also showcases an outstanding collection of Galena pottery. Tours of the house, lasting 30 minutes, are available.
